Applications of 21567-18-0
The applications of 4-(4-Chlorophenoxy)phenol are diverse:
- Pharmaceuticals: Used as an intermediate in the synthesis of drugs due to its biological activity.
- Agriculture: Functions as an herbicide or pesticide component.
- Industrial Chemicals: Employed in the production of dyes and other organic compounds.
Its unique properties make it valuable in both research and commercial applications.
Biological Activity of 21567-18-0
Research indicates that 4-(4-Chlorophenoxy)phenol exhibits notable biological activities. It has been identified as an inhibitor of various cytochrome P450 enzymes, specifically CYP1A2 and CYP2C19, which are crucial in drug metabolism. Additionally, it demonstrates antimicrobial properties, making it relevant in the development of antiseptics and disinfectants.
